26 Wash and Wear Hairstyles for Women Over 70

Looking for easy-to-maintain hair? These 26 wash and wear hairstyles for women over 70 combine style and practicality. You’ll find options that work with your natural texture, require minimal styling, and help you feel confident without spending hours in front of the mirror.

Cropped Shag with Bangs

A photo of a 72-year-old Mary, cropped shag with bangs hairstyle, front view, living room background.Pin

You’ll love how this cropped shag frames your face with lively layers and bangs.

The shaggy texture gives you plenty of movement with minimal styling.

Just wash, add a bit of mousse, and let it air dry.

The bangs soften your features while the cropped length keeps maintenance low.

Perfect for busy days when you want to look put-together quickly.

Shoulder-Length Curls

A photo of a 74-year-old Melissa, shoulder-length curls hairstyle, front view, living room background.Pin

Your natural curls look stunning in this shoulder-length cut designed to enhance your curl pattern.

You’ll love how the strategic layers prevent triangle shape while allowing your curls to spring freely.

After washing, apply curl cream, scrunch gently, and either air dry or diffuse.

The length gives you styling options while the curls create beautiful natural volume.
